diff options
Diffstat (limited to 'math/vtk-data/Makefile')
-rw-r--r-- | math/vtk-data/Makefile | 17 |
1 files changed, 11 insertions, 6 deletions
diff --git a/math/vtk-data/Makefile b/math/vtk-data/Makefile index dd23ddf90af8..52b5c4dca4bb 100644 --- a/math/vtk-data/Makefile +++ b/math/vtk-data/Makefile @@ -6,17 +6,17 @@ # PKGNAMESUFFIX= -data -DISTFILES= VTKData-${PORTVERSION}-cvs${CVSDATE}.tar.gz +DISTFILES= VTKData-${PORTVERSION}.tar.gz COMMENT= The Visualization Toolkit examples data -BROKEN= Unfetchable - MASTERDIR= ${.CURDIR}/../vtk MD5_FILE= ${.CURDIR}/distinfo -WRKSRC= ${WRKDIR}/VTKData -PKGMESSAGE= ${.CURDIR}/pkg-message +WRKSRC= ${WRKDIR}/VTKData-release-${PORTVERSION} +SUB_FILES= pkg-message +PKGMESSAGE= ${WRKDIR}/pkg-message +INSTFILES= Baseline Data VTKData.readme do-configure: @@ -28,7 +28,12 @@ do-install: @${MKDIR} ${EXAMPLESDIR} @${MKDIR} ${VTKDATAROOT} @${ECHO_MSG} "Installing VTKData to ${EXAMPLESDIR} ..." - @${CP} -R ${WRKSRC}/* ${VTKDATAROOT} +.for i in ${INSTFILES} + @cd ${WRKSRC} && \ + ${FIND} ${i} -type d -exec ${MKDIR} ${VTKDATAROOT}/{} \; && \ + ${FIND} ${i} \! -type d -exec ${INSTALL_DATA} {} ${VTKDATAROOT}/{} \; +.endfor + @${RMDIR} ${VTKDATAROOT}/Baseline/Common # empty .include "${MASTERDIR}/Makefile" .include <bsd.port.post.mk> |